Water Heater Maintenance in Denver, CO
Water heater maintenance services include routine inspections, flushing, and component checks to ensure optimal performance and longevity of the unit. These projects typically involve removing sediment buildup, testing temperature and pressure relief valves, and inspecting connections and thermostats. Property owners often seek maintenance to prevent unexpected breakdowns, improve energy efficiency, and extend the lifespan of their water heater, especially in regions with hard water or aging equipment.
Before requesting water heater maintenance, homeowners should understand the type and age of their unit, as well as any specific issues experienced, such as inconsistent hot water or unusual noises. Clarifying whether the service includes flushing, part replacement, or system adjustments can help set expectations. Proper maintenance can contribute to reliable hot water supply and help avoid costly repairs or early replacements.

Common Water Heater Maintenance Jobs
Water heater maintenance services help ensure reliable hot water supply and extend the lifespan of the unit.
Periodic flushing removes sediment buildup that can reduce efficiency and cause damage.
Anode rod inspection and replacement prevent tank corrosion and leaks.
Thermostat checks and adjustments help maintain safe and optimal water temperatures.
Leak detection and repair services address small issues before they become costly problems.

Water Heater Maintenance Questions
Why is regular water heater maintenance important? Regular maintenance helps ensure efficient operation, extends the lifespan of the unit, and prevents unexpected breakdowns.
What does water heater maintenance typically include? It usually involves flushing the tank, inspecting the anode rod, checking for leaks, and testing the temperature and pressure relief valve.
How often should a water heater be serviced? It is recommended to have maintenance performed once a year to keep the system running smoothly.
Can maintenance improve energy efficiency? Yes, keeping the water heater in good condition can help reduce energy consumption and lower utility bills.
